Solar cell power generation angle

Solar cell power generation angle

Simple is the basic idea of controlling solar panel efficiency: panels generate the maximum power when sunlight strikes their surface perpendicularly, therefore forming a direct 90-degree angle. The photovoltaic cells absorb the most solar energy available at that instant when the sun's rays strike. . The tilt angle directly influences how much solar radiation your photovoltaic panels capture throughout the year. Panels positioned perpendicular to the sun's rays absorb maximum energy, but the sun's position changes with seasons and your geographic location. An easy method for determining solar panel tilt is to match the latitude of your home. [pdf]

Can a 100w solar cell generate electricity

Can a 100w solar cell generate electricity

A 100W solar panel can generate approximately 400 to 600 watt-hours of electricity per day under optimal conditions such as full sun exposure for six to eight hours. This production rate may vary due to several factors, including seasonal changes, geographic location, and daily. . A 100 watt solar panel is perfectly sized for keeping all your small electronic devices—like phones, tablets, and even most standard laptops—fully charged throughout the day.
